Meaning of retracted

Source language: EnglishDictionary language: English

retracted

verb

Definitions

  1. To pull back inside.

    Example: An airplane retracts its wheels for flight.

  2. To draw back; to draw up.

    Example: A cat can retract its claws.

  3. To take back or withdraw something one has said.

    Example: I retract all the accusations I made about the senator and sincerely hope he won't sue me.

  4. To take back, as a grant or favour previously bestowed; to revoke.

adjective

Definitions

  1. Withdrawn back and in, as the claws of a cat

  2. (of a sound) pronounced further back in the vocal tract

    Synonyms:backed
    Antonyms:advancedfronted
  3. Couped by a line diagonal to the main direction
